Re: [XO Wave] Re: XOengine terminates immediately


On Jan 21, 2007, at 4:19 PM, gmilmei wrote:

> --- In xowave@yahoogroups.com, Bjorn Roche <bjorn@...> wrote:
> >> I should mention that the most likely cause of this error is
> that you
> > are combining different versions of XO Wave components. For example,
> > an old XOmux and a newer XOengine. Usually, the installer cleans the
> > old installation out and completely replaces it, but if you moved
> any
> > program components by hand, the installer won't have known about it,
> > and you'll have to delete the old stuff manually because you must
> > keep all program components at the same version.
> >
> > If you've forgotten where you put things, you can try using commands
> > such as:
> >
> > locate xo
> > locate XOengine
> > locate xowave
> > locate XOmux
> >
> > to help find things.
> It is a completely fresh install, with no previous components.
> However, I removed everyone of the supplied libraries except
> libjack-0.100.0.so.0, since on my system (Fedora Core 6) jack is
> at version 0.102.

I will send you (privately) a build of XOengine that will tell me
what arguments it's receiving. If you send me the output from that, I
should be able to figure out what's going on.
